Good evening fellow reefers!

I’ve been in the hobby for around 10yrs keeping only softies and LPs with success. I picked up this bubble tip anemone today at a mom and pop lfs (multiple were given to them from a fellow hobbyists that split from mother colony). I got it home a few hours ago and noticed this white ring around the base of tents. This is my 1st anemone ever. I fed it some mysis which it took. Just curious about this white ring? Tank has been set up for a year with well established LPs and softie corals.

Photo was taken like an hour into the tank. Since photo the tentacles have expanded and puffed up more but still the white around base
9F030B44-D5AA-4979-A9F7-A14AE3F0E6E5.jpeg
 
The white ring is just part of the coloration on the oral disk
 
The white ring is just part of the coloration on the oral disk
Okay, so nothing to worry about? I know the anemone wasn’t under the best lighting at the store. I plan on feeding it a little every other day & keeping an eye out if it wants to go on a walk
 
dont feed it yet. Allow it to settle for a few weeks first. More likely to annoy it then help it if you try to feed it too soon after getting it
